We created Kuźnia for students who want to study regularly, understand their schoolwork, ask challenging questions and develop their interests in mathematics, physics or computer science.
Why we do this
Students may come to us with a specific need: preparing for a competition or Olympiad, catching up or getting ready for their next lesson or test. Each is a good starting point.
We want students to understand how to reach an answer, as well as the answer itself. We strengthen foundations, introduce methods and leave room for independent attempts. This makes progress last beyond a single test.

Meet the Kuźnia teamSupport and partnerships
Jane Street is Kuźnia's ongoing sponsor. Partners of selected mini PreOM and PreOM editions have included Stanisław Staszic High School No. 14 in Warsaw, the University of Warsaw's Faculty of Mathematics, Informatics and Mechanics (MIM UW), and its Faculty of Physics (FUW).
Many of our instructors graduated from Staszic's experimental mathematics classes, known as “matex”. This gives us a good understanding of the school's curriculum, pace and individual teachers' approaches.
